Background
Hydraulic engineering is an engineering built for controlling and allocating surface water and underground water in the nature to achieve the purpose of removing harm and benefiting, also called water engineering, water is a valuable resource essential for human production and life, but the naturally existing state of the water does not completely meet the needs of human beings, and water flow can be controlled only by building the hydraulic engineering to prevent flood disasters and adjust and distribute water quantity to meet the needs of people for life and production on water resources. The water conservancy construction often need get into the underground and carry out the construction operation during the construction, because the polytropy of underground construction environment leads to it to threaten constructor's life safety to a certain extent, so when carrying out water conservancy construction, need equip special support protection device to this guarantees constructor's life safety, current water conservancy construction supports protection device, mainly adopts the support column to support, and such supporting method exists these some shortcomings and not enough.
The current products have the following disadvantages:
1. although the device is provided with the wheels, the device is limited only by the brake pads of the wheels, is easy to shake and move under the action of external force and is not safe and stable enough;
2. the existing device adopts various motors and transmission mechanisms, and the device is complex.

Referring to fig. 1 to 3, the present invention provides a technical solution: the utility model provides a hydraulic engineering construction is with supporting protection device, including universal wheel 1, one side swing joint of universal wheel 1 has limiting plate 2, the top swing joint of universal wheel 1 has device platform 3, one side fixedly connected with push rod 4 of device platform 3, the opposite side of device platform 3 is pegged graft and is had picture peg 5, the top of device platform 3 is pegged graft and is had stake 6, one side fixedly connected with rotary column 7 of stake 6, the groove of holing 8 has been seted up at the top of stake 6, the bottom fixedly connected with drill bit 9 of stake 6, the top fixedly connected with hydraulic press 10 of device platform 3, the top swing joint of hydraulic press 10 has hydraulic column 11, one side fixedly connected with bracing piece 12 of hydraulic column 11, the top fixedly connected with backup pad 13 of hydraulic column 11.
As an optimal technical solution of the utility model: the universal wheel 1 is movably connected with the mounting platform 3 through a wheel shaft, the number of the universal wheels 1 is four, a push rod 4 is used for moving the device easily through the universal wheel 1, the limiting plate 2 is made of rubber, the top of the mounting platform 3 is provided with a round hole matched with the pile 6, one side of the mounting platform 3 is provided with a jack matched with the plug board 5, the limiting plate 2 can preliminarily limit the device, one side of the pile 6 is provided with a slotted hole matched with the plug board 5, the pile 6 is made of steel, the pile 6 is fixedly connected with two rotary columns 7, one part of the plug board 5 enters the pile 6 to fix the position of the pile 6, the punching groove 8 is square, the hydraulic machine 10 is fixedly connected with the middle part of the top of the mounting platform 3, an installation head of the rotary machine can be placed into the punching groove 8 to drive the rotary columns 6 to rotate, so that the drill bit 9 drills into the ground, and the hydraulic column 11 is movably connected with the middle part of the top of the hydraulic machine 10, the support rod 12 is fixedly connected with the bottom of the support plate 13, and the support rod 12 can further enhance the supporting capability of the support plate 13.
When the user uses, uses push rod 4 to pass through 1 mobile device of universal wheel to preset position, uses limiting plate 2 to carry on spacingly to universal wheel 1, extracts picture peg 5, makes stake 6 and drill bit 9 bore through rotary column 7 or drilling groove 8 and moves, bores in the ground to improve the overall stability of device, start hydraulic press 10, hydraulic pressure post 11 rises, thereby makes backup pad 13 rise, carries out construction work.
